The Portuguese Way starts at Lagos (Algarve capital), crosses Lisbon, Coimbra, Porto and Valença do Mihno. In Germany there are also some St. James’ Ways: The old Saxon Route from Bautzen to Hof. St. Boniface's Route, from Hochheim to Fulda, crossing Frankfurt am Main. Boniface was a German apostle. The Ecumenican Way: from Görlitz (Zgorzelec in Poland) to Vacha. This route meets at Fulda with other ways to Santiago which go eastwards: through Frankfurt am Main and Köln, to Trier or going towards Strasbourg (France).
